Medical Assistant


 

The Medical Assistant 2 is the first point of contact for patient care. Responsible for administrative duties in addition to patient care. The Medical Assistant 2 performs varied activities and moderately complex administrative/operational/customer support assignments. Performs computations. Typically works on semi-routine assignments.

Responsibilities

Job Description

This position will be field-based for in-home patient visits and require daily driving. This position will be servicing parts of Clayton, Cobb, Dekalb, Fulton, Jasper, Newton, Rockdale, and Walton Counties.

This position starts in Central Atlanta and would be helpful if our ideal hire resided in one of the following areas: Sandy Springs, Roswell, Milton, Norcross, Lilburn, Hapeville, Douglasville, Alpharetta, Johns Creek, Woodstock, Duluth, Clarkston, Avondale Estates, Decatur, Kennesaw, Smyrna, Acworth, Powder Springs, Macon, or Dacula, Georgia.

The Medical Assistant 2 performs clinical duties such as discussing symptoms and gathering and inputting information into the electronic medical records system, taking vital signs, giving injections, performing diagnostic tests, collecting specimens, drawing blood, sterilizing and cleaning equipment, and maintaining examination rooms at an outpatient care site. Collaborates closely with Physicians and Nurses. Delivers direct patient care dependent on what active certification allows. Decisions are typically focus on interpretation of area/department policy and methods for completing assignments. Works within defined parameters to identify work expectations and quality standards, but has some latitude over prioritization/timing, and works under minimal direction. Follows standard policies/practices that allow for some opportunity for interpretation/deviation and/or independent discretion.

Required Qualifications

  • 1 - 3 years of Medical Assistant experience in 'back-office' direct patient care.

  • Applicable diploma or certification in field of study (RMA/CMA).

  • Current CPR certification.

  • This role is considered patient facing and is part of Humana's Tuberculosis (TB) screening program. If selected for this role, you will be required to be screened for TB.

  • Must be a team player with excellent communication skills.

  • Hands-on professional Phlebotomy experience, Phlebotomy certified, or willing to obtain certification prior to employment.

  • Experience in a fast pace/high volume environment.

  • Basic computer knowledge and experience with MS Outlook.

  • Ability to travel to multiple site locations.

  • Must be passionate about contributing to an organization focused on continuously improving consumer experiences.

  • Reliable transportation, proof of auto insurance, and a clean driving record through DMV.

  • This role is part of Humana's Driver safety program and therefore requires an individual to have a valid state driver's license and proof of personal vehicle liability insurance with at least 100/300/100 limits.

Preferred Qualifications

  • Bilingual

  • Certified Phlebotomist

  • Experience with Electronic Medical Records

  • Experience with HEDIS measures

  • Active Medical Assistant Certification or Registration from the following: American Association of Medical Assistant (AAMA), National Healthcareer Association, American Registry of Medical Assistants, National Association for Health Professionals, and/or American Medical Technologist
